AAnimations

Animations are motion sequences that are used in video games to make characters, objects or environments appear alive and realistic. They ensure that characters can run, jump, fight or interact with the game world.

In addition to game characters, environmental details such as wave movements, smoke or lighting effects are also animated to make the gaming experience more immersive.

BBots

Bots are computer-controlled characters or opponents in gaming. They are often used to enhance the gaming experience when no human players are available or to increase the level of difficulty. Bots can take on different roles, e.g. as opponents in a multiplayer game or as allies in cooperative game modes.

In competitive games, however, bots can also be perceived negatively if they are used by players to perform automated tasks or cheats, such as farming resources or exploiting game bugs.

CCombo

A combo (short for "combination") is a sequence of actions or attacks in quick succession in a video game, usually used in fighting or action games. By entering a specific sequence of buttons or movements, the player can execute a series of punches, kicks or special attacks that often overwhelm the opponent and cause additional damage.

CCooldown

Cooldown in video games, a cooldown is the amount of time that must elapse after using a skill, item or action before it can be used again. Cooldowns are often used in video games;Role-playing games or action games. The strategic planning of cool-downs is essential for success in competitive games.

EEaster Egg

In the world of video games, an "Easter Egg" is a hidden feature, a secret message or a hidden item that developers have deliberately integrated into the game.

These surprises are often difficult to find and require the player to perform special actions or explore unusual areas of the game. They often serve as a nod to pop culture, previous games or inside jokes from the developers.

The term is derived from the tradition of the Easter egg hunt, where the aim is to find hidden objects. We occasionally reveal our Easter eggs in our blog.

FFarming

Farming in virtual games refers to the repeated collection of resources, items or experience points by repeatedly completing the same tasks (or defeating certain opponents). The term originates from role-playing games and MMORPGs, where players specifically "farm" in certain areas in order to obtain rare items or materials.

FFPS

There are two terms for this abbreviation in gaming:

FPS – Frames per Second: This refers to the number of images that are displayed on the screen per second. The higher the FPS rate, the smoother the game runs. An FPS value of 30 to 60 is roughly standard.

FPS - First-person shooter: Das is a genre of video games in which the player experiences the game world from a first-person perspective. In FPS games, the player usually controls a character who uses weapons to fight opponents.

GGame Engine

A game engine is the technical basis on which video games are developed. It provides developers with tools and resources to integrate graphics, animations, artificial intelligence and sounds.

Famous game engines such as the Unreal Engine, Unity or the Frostbite Engine have enabled both large studios and indie developers to create impressive games. Pre-built features allow developers to work more efficiently and focus on design and content instead of programming basic technologies from scratch.

GGlitch

A glitch is an unexpected error in a gamethat often leads to unusual behavior. In contrast to bugs, which can cause serious problems, glitches are often minor, temporary glitches that do not make the game unplayable, but can have strange effects. Examples of glitches are graphic errors, a character getting stuck in objects or the unintentional traversal of walls. You can report such bugs to our support team.

Some glitches can be exploited by players to gain advantages. This is then called an „exploit“.

GGrinding

Grinding in games describes the repeated completion of certain tasks or actions in order to achieve progress, such as collecting experience points, resources or items. It is particularly typical for role-playing games and online multiplayer games.

Although grinding is sometimes perceived as monotonous, it can also be rewarding when players are rewarded for their perseverance with coveted items or tangible progress. The right mix of challenge and reward makes grinding a motivating element in many games.

MMMO (Massively Multiplayer Online)

An MMO is an online game with a very large number of games;number of playersplay simultaneously in the same virtual game world. The game worlds in MMOs are usually persistent, which means that they exist continuously and change even when the player is offline. Players in MMOs can communicate with each other, cooperate or compete against each other.

NNerf

In the context of video games, a nerf is a deliberate weakening of certain game functions, characters, weapons or abilities by the developers. This is usually done to better balance the game if an element is perceived as too strong or too powerful and thus makes the gameplay unfair.
Nerfs are often created after feedback from the player community
(at upjers and others via the forum) or through analysis by the developers to ensure that the game remains competitive and fair.

NNPC

An NPC, short for "Non-Player Character", is a character in a video game that is not controlled by the player, but by the game's AI (artificial intelligence). NPCs can take on different roles, such as allies, enemies or neutral characters. They often serve as quest givers, merchants or sources of information.

Although NPCs are not directly controlled by the player, they often interact with the player or their character and can influence the game experience through dialog, actions or reactions.

PPatch

A patch is an update or software correction released by the developers of a video game to fix bugs, glitches or security flaws in the game. Patches can also be used to add new content, improve balancing or optimize existing game mechanics. They are usually made available after the launch of the game to respond to problems or player feedback.

Regular patches are common in online games to maintain the game and improve the gaming experience over time. We report in detail about our patches in the games in the forum.

PPing

Ping describes the time it takes for a data packet to travel from the device to the player:get inside to a server and back again. This time is measured in milliseconds (ms).

A low ping means faster data transmission and therefore a responsive, smooth connection to the game server. A high ping, on the other hand, leads to delays, also known as "latency" or "lag". This delay is particularly problematic in online games such as shooters or real-time strategy games.

SShoot 'em up

Shoot ’em up games – often abbreviated to „Shmups“ – are a subgenre of action games and are often colloquially referred to as ball games. The player controls a character or object – usually a spaceship or a fighter – and continuously fires at approaching enemies. The playing field scrolls automatically, usually horizontally or vertically, so that the player has to keep moving and dodge enemy projectiles.

VVertical Shooter

A Vertical Shooter – also known as Vertical Scroller – is a subcategory of Shoot ’em up games. In this type of game, the playing field moves vertically from bottom to top, where the player typically controls a spaceship, jet or similar object.The aim is to eliminate opponents with continuous fire while avoiding obstacles and enemy projectiles. The game is usually displayed in top-down perspective, with the game action continuously scrolling upwards.

WWave

In the gaming context, a wave refers to a group of enemies that approach the player at regular intervals or level phases. This concept is particularly popular in tower defense games, survival modes and action games.

Waves often become more difficult as the game progresses by containing stronger or more numerous enemies. Players will need to adapt their resources, strategies and skills to successfully complete successive waves.

Defeating a complete wave is often rewarded with rewards such as points, equipment or a short breather.
